Benefits of IH Technology in Rice Cooking
IH (Induction Heating) technology is a game changer in the world of rice cooking. Unlike traditional electric rice cookers that rely on a heating element, IH rice cookers use electromagnetic induction to heat the pot directly. This leads to more precise temperature control, which is crucial for achieving perfectly cooked rice every time. The even distribution of heat ensures that rice cooks evenly, reducing the chances of burning or undercooking.

Maintenance Tips for Your IH Rice Cooker
Taking care of your IH rice cooker not only extends its lifespan but also ensures optimal performance. Regular cleaning is essential, especially after cooking sticky or heavily flavored rice. Always let the pot cool down before washing it, and use a non-abrasive sponge or cloth to avoid scratching the non-stick surface. The inner lid, steam vent, and rubber gaskets should also be cleaned periodically to prevent the buildup of rice starch or odors.
It’s important to refer to the manufacturer’s manual for specific care instructions. Some models have removable and washable components, while others require special attention to maintain their internal parts. Pay close attention to the heating plate, as residue can accumulate and affect cooking performance. Keeping these areas clean should be a priority for every IH rice cooker user.
In addition to cleaning, proper storage is crucial. Always ensure that the cooker is completely dry before storing it. This will prevent moisture buildup that can lead to mold and other issues. It’s also advisable to keep the rice cooker in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and heat sources.

What is an IH rice cooker?
An IH rice cooker, or induction heating rice cooker, uses advanced technology to cook rice with precision. Instead of the conventional heating methods, it employs induction heating which enables it to provide even heat distribution, creating the perfect cooking environment for rice. This technology allows the cooker to adjust temperatures rapidly and retains heat for better texture and taste.
The induction heating also helps in creating a less humid cooking environment, preventing the rice from becoming overly soggy or sticky. With these benefits, IH rice cookers are often considered more efficient and capable of producing higher-quality rice compared to standard rice cookers. They’re suitable for various rice types, making them a versatile addition to any kitchen.

What is fuzzy logic technology in IH rice cookers?
Fuzzy logic technology is an innovative feature found in many IH rice cookers that enhances their cooking capabilities. This technology uses sensors to determine the rice’s moisture content and other factors during cooking. The cooker then automatically adjusts the temperature and cooking time to ensure ideal cooking results for the type of rice being prepared.
With fuzzy logic, users do not have to worry about precise measurements or manual adjustments, as the cooker intelligently adapts to the specifics of the cooking process. This can lead to more consistent results and improved texture and flavor, making it a popular choice for both novice and experienced cooks looking for convenience and accuracy in their rice preparation.
How do I choose the right size of IH rice cooker for my needs?
Selecting the right size IH rice cooker primarily depends on your household’s rice consumption and cooking habits. For an average family of 3 to 5 members, a cooker with a capacity of 5.5 cups of uncooked rice is generally sufficient, yielding about 11 cups of cooked rice. If you frequently host guests or have larger family meals, consider a larger model, ranging from 10 to 12 cups.
Additionally, consider how often you cook rice and the types you prepare. If you enjoy variety in your meals or sometimes cook for larger gatherings, opting for a cooker with a higher capacity can be a worthwhile investment. Always think about your kitchen space as well, ensuring that the rice cooker will fit comfortably on your countertop or in storage when not in use.
